Why Sliding Patio Doors May Not Be the Best Choice for Large Homes

They Work, But They Rarely Use The Whole Opening Well

For many houses, a sliding patio door is perfectly adequate. The problem shows up when the home is larger, the opening is wider, or the design calls for something with more presence.

Large homes ask more of a door than basic access. They need proportion, movement, and a visual connection that does not look pinched in the frame.

Where Sliding Patio Doors Start To Feel Limiting

On a large exterior wall, that division can weaken the whole composition. Instead of a wide, airy transition to the patio, the eye sees a narrow passage framed by two panels of glass.

The second issue is the opening width. A slider usually leaves only part of the opening usable at one time, which can be awkward when people are moving in and out during gatherings.

Furniture layout becomes more sensitive in larger rooms. A slider may be convenient near a compact breakfast nook, but in a spacious great room it can dictate where sofas, consoles, or side tables can go.

There is also the matter of everyday feel. A sliding door can work smoothly, but it rarely delivers the same sense of arrival as a pair of doors or a multi-panel opening.

The Hidden Costs Of Choosing The Easier Option

Design expectations rise with home size. A basic slider can feel generic on a custom facade, especially if the house has tall windows, detailed trim, or a more traditional profile.

What Tends To Work Better In Spacious Floor Plans

For many large homes, the better answer is a wider opening with more glass and more flexible operation. Multi-slide systems, French doors, and double door combinations often give the space a more balanced look.

Each option brings its own trade-offs, but the key is matching the door to how the space is actually used. A family that opens the patio daily has different needs than one that uses the rear door mainly for entertaining.

A few styles tend to perform especially well in bigger homes:

  • multi-slide systems for wide openings
  • French doors when the home calls for symmetry
  • double doors for a strong centerline and formal feel
  • custom configurations when the opening does not suit a stock layout

A Practical Way To Choose The Right Patio Door

A sliding door is not automatically the wrong answer. In a few situations, it remains the most sensible option, particularly when the floor plan leaves little room for swinging panels or when the project has a firm budget.

Before you choose, step back and evaluate three basics: the opening size, the function of the doorway, and how visible it is from the main living areas and the yard.

The strongest outcome usually comes from respecting the scale of the house. When the door size and style line up with the architecture, the entire rear elevation feels more finished and more expensive.

A thoughtful patio door choice should make the room easier to use, improve the view, and fit the house without drawing attention to itself. When a sliding door cannot do all three, it is worth considering a better fit for the space.
